Transaction 90eb62ccd16528f4415e98f1ca6102e3aafa0d76158a80c3b1630353a30c5bea

1 Input
2 Outputs
  • 90eb62ccd16528f4415e98f1ca6102e3aafa0d76158a80c3b1630353a30c5bea:0
  • value  1861544
    address  1MPe3As1Ppb6Etnp4iSyEzJRriep4kn3HE
  • 90eb62ccd16528f4415e98f1ca6102e3aafa0d76158a80c3b1630353a30c5bea:1
  • value  3994833
    address  15PW76hM9WEYi5Q6QpFwxPcUsjoGFJiJ5c